Output ece7281821385bf5c551e3af6b3d378a7fbe8d98f32f9f1bf369b61e94d3b415:0

value
697841453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ca23fab7c5b99c520a110f2bad2dac28fe3804c3 OP_EQUAL
address
3L7qXBcHSSY9PERFfHXaAHNa65w2Kgo7Ex
transaction
ece7281821385bf5c551e3af6b3d378a7fbe8d98f32f9f1bf369b61e94d3b415
spent
true